Mixing kerosene with alcohol creates a heterogeneous mixture where the two liquids do not dissolve into each other. This results in two distinct layers due to the difference in their densities and non-polar nature of kerosene which does not mix with the polar molecules of alcohol. Such mixtures should be handled with care due to their potential flammability and toxicity.
